The Morocco Fibre Optic Cables Market is set for steady expansion during the forecast period, driven by the government's increasing focus on digital infrastructure and the growing demand for high-speed internet connectivity. The Moroccan government is actively promoting the adoption of fibre optic networks as part of its national strategy to improve broadband penetration, especially in rural areas, and to enhance the overall quality of digital services.
According to 6Wresearch, the Morocco fibre optic cables market is projected to grow at a CAGR of 7.2% during 2025-2031. This growth is fueled by the rising demand for digital services, increased investments in the telecom sector, and a strategic focus on 5G network deployment. As digital transformation accelerates in Morocco, sectors such as IT, telecommunications, and banking require advanced fibre optic infrastructure to support high-speed internet and data transmission. The rollout of 5G, particularly in urban centers, is a significant driver, as fibre optics are critical for managing the vast data needs of this next-generation technology. Furthermore, the adoption of cloud computing, data centers, and IoT technologies is pushing demand for robust fibre optic networks capable of handling larger data volumes efficiently. This trend is reflected in the Morocco Fibre Optic Cables Market Growth.
However, the market faces challenges such as high initial installation costs, difficulties in laying cables in remote or mountainous regions, and potential regulatory delays that can hinder deployment timelines. Despite these barriers, the market outlook remains positive, with increasing public and private sector investments aimed at improving Morocco's digital infrastructure. Government initiatives to bridge the digital divide, especially in rural areas, and strategic partnerships with global technology providers are expected to offset these challenges. These efforts are poised to accelerate fibre optic cable deployment across the country, driving further market growth in the coming years.
Key market trends include the increasing preference for single-mode fibre optic cables due to their ability to provide high-speed internet over long distances with minimal signal loss. As the demand for reliable internet continues to grow, single-mode cables are expected to dominate the market in terms of both deployment and investment.
Another significant trend is the rising adoption of glass optical fibres, which offer better performance and durability compared to plastic fibres, making them suitable for high-capacity data transmission in critical sectors such as IT, telecom, and defense.

Key players in the Morocco fibre optic cables market include Prysmian Group, Nexans, and Sterlite Technologies. These companies are well known for their extensive product portfolios and their ongoing investments in R&D to provide high-quality, durable, and cost-effective fibre optic cables.

According to Ravi Bhandari, Research Head, 6Wresearch, The single-mode cable segment is expected to dominate the market, driven by its capability to transmit high-speed data over long distances with minimal signal loss, making it ideal for IT and telecom applications.
Glass optical fiber is anticipated to lead in the market due to its superior durability and performance compared to plastic optical fibers, particularly in high-speed data applications.
The IT and telecom sector is expected to register significant growth, as digital transformation accelerates and the need for robust data transmission infrastructure becomes more critical.
